An Irish Country Christmas Patrick Taylor
An Irish Country Christmas
Patrick Taylor
Forge, Oct 28 2008, $24.95
ISBN: 0765320703
In the quaint Irish village of Ballybucklebo, Dr. Fingal O'Reilly and his partner Dr. Barry Laverty deal as always with the vast ailments of the townsfolk while also dealing with respective attractions to the opposite sex. Fingal has doubts about courting effervescent Kitty O'Halloran except when he is near her; than he has no rational thought. Barry is upset because his girlfriend Patricia Spence at Girton College informs him she may not make it in time for his first Christmas in the small Irish village.
However, all that pales compared to a new doctor in town who steals their patients with remedies that should have the man barred. To country doctors O'Reilly and Laverty, Dr. Fitzpatrick should be called Dr. Quack, but as ridiculous as his prescriptions are, he is gaining patients.
The third Irish County medical cozy (see 'An Irish Country Doctor' and 'An Irish Country Village') is a fun tale as O'Reilly and Laverty continues to take care of the villagers by combining modern medical practices with homespun 'cures' like dressing up as Santa. The storyline is warm and uplifting even when Patricia looks like she will not make for the holidays and Fitzpatrick causes harm to the patients he steals. Readers who enjoyed the previous entries will especially want to read this one as the two physicians spend their first holiday season with fans.
